Justin Welby, who was diagnosed with pneumonia on Thursday, was due to preach at St Paul’s Cathedral on Friday
The archbishop of Canterbury will miss the service of thanksgiving for the Queen’s reign this week after being diagnosed with pneumonia and testing positive for Covid.
Justin Welby had been due to preach at St Paul’s Cathedral on Friday. Stephen Cottrell, the archbishop of York, will take his place.
